What is the ICD-10 code for hang-glider explosion injuring occupant?

The ICD-10-CM code for hang-glider explosion injuring occupant is V96.15. The full clinical description is "Hang-glider explosion injuring occupant". V96.15 is a non-billable header code. Use a more specific child code for billing purposes.

What does ICD-10 code V96.15 mean?

ICD-10-CM code V96.15 represents "Hang-glider explosion injuring occupant". It is classified under Chapter 21: External Causes of Morbidity and is a non-billable header code. Use a more specific child code for billing purposes.

Is V96.15 a billable code?

No, V96.15 is a non-billable header code. You need to use one of its more specific child codes for billing. There are 3 child codes under V96.15.

What chapter is V96.15 in?

V96.15 is in Chapter 21: External Causes of Morbidity (codes V00-Y99).

What codes cannot be used with V96.15?

V96.15 has Excludes1 notes indicating codes that cannot be used together with it, including: military aircraft accidents in military or war operations (Y36, Y37).

What are the subcategories under V96.15?

V96.15 has 3 child codes, including: V96.15XA (Hang-glider explosion injuring occupant, initial encounter), V96.15XD (Hang-glider explosion injuring occupant, subs encntr), V96.15XS (Hang-glider explosion injuring occupant, sequela).
